Why this rating

This daycare earned 5 out of 5 stars overall. Structural quality reflects a license in good standing. The structural rating also includes Kansas's licensing baseline — what every licensed daycare in the state must meet. Kansas caps infant ratios at 1:3, toddler ratios at 1:6, and preschool ratios at 1:12. Lead teachers must hold a High School Diploma. Teachers must complete 16 hours of annual training. No objective process measures (e.g., state quality rating or national accreditation) are available for this daycare. The overall rating reflects structural features only.

Across 1 inspection since 2025, the issues cited most often were Emergency Preparedness & Drills (1) and Staff Qualifications & Background Checks (1). None of the 2 findings were critical.

  1. May 15, 20252 Findings1 Important1 Administrative
    • Safety and Emergency ProceduresK.A.R. 28-4-128

      Facility emergency plan needs to include a plan for Heavy Snow/Blizzard and a plan for unscheduled closing.

    • Initial and Ongoing Professional Development TrainingK.A.R. 28-4-114a

      Two providers need documentation of current Pediatric First Aid and CPR on file
